Card Counting In Blackjack
If you are an enthusiast of blackjack then you have to be conscious of the reality that in 21 a handful of actions of your previous performance could have an affect your future play. It is unlike other gambling den games such as roulette or craps in which there is little effect of the preceding plays on the up-and-coming one. In vingt-et-un if a gambler has additional cards of large proportion then it’s constructive for the gambler in future games and if the player has bad cards, it disparagingly alters his future games. In practically all of the instances it is astonishingly challenging for the player to recount the cards that have been played in the preceding games notably in the several deck dealing shoe. Each and every remaining card in the pack receives a positive, negative or zero number for card counting.
As a rule it is observed that cards with lower points like 2, 3 have positive distinction and the higher cards make a a negative value. The different value is attached for all cards based on the card counting scheme. Though it’s smarter to make a count on card counter’s own guesstimate as it relates to cards dealt and undealt cards occasionally the card counter will be able to acquire a tally of the point totals in their mind. This is likely to help you to determine the precise percentage or total of cards that are left in the pack. You need to understand that the higher the card totals the harder the counting process is. Multiple-level card counting intensifies the difficulty whereas the counting activity that is comprised of lower total for instance 1, -1, 0 referred to as level 1 count is the easiest.
Once it comes to getting 21 then the importance of the ace is above every other card. Consequently dealing with aces is very crucial in the process of card counting in twenty-one.
The player is able to put larger bets if the shoe of cards is in his favour and lower wagers when the shoe is not. The player is able to adjust their decisions according to the cards and bet with a secure course of action. If the method of card counting is absolutely legitimate and accurate the affect on the game will be favorable, this is why the gambling dens deploy counteractions to stop counting cards.
